Scientific Description

Family Epacridaceae.

Habit and leaf form. Shrubs; evergreen; leptocaul, or pachycaul. Helophytic to xerophytic. Leaves small to medium-sized; alternate; spiral, or four-ranked; ‘herbaceous’, or leathery; imbricate; petiolate to sessile; sheathing. Leaf sheaths with free margins. Leaves simple. Leaf blades entire; flat; parallel-veined; cross-venulate, or without cross-venules. Leaves without stipules. Leaf blade margins flat. Stem anatomy. Nodes tri-lacunar to multilacunar (? Richeoideae having 3 or more vascular traces to each leaf). Secondary thickening developing from a conventional cambial ring.

Reproductive type, pollination. Fertile flowers hermaphrodite. Unisexual flowers absent. Plants hermaphrodite. Entomophilous, or ornithophilous. Pollination mechanism unspecialized.

Inflorescence and flower features. Flowers aggregated in ‘inflorescences’; in spikes, or in heads. Inflorescences simple; axillary. Flowers bracteate. Bracts persistent. Flowers bracteolate; small; fragrant, or odourless; regular; 5 merous; cyclic; tetracyclic. Free hypanthium absent. Hypogynous disk present, or absent; intrastaminal; of separate members, or annular. Perianth with distinct calyx and corolla; 10; 2 -whorled; isomerous. Calyx 5; 1 -whorled; polysepalous; imbricate; exceeded by the corolla; regular; persistent. Corolla 5; 1 -whorled; gamopetalous; lobed (lobes horizontally spreading). Corolla lobes markedly shorter than the tube, or about the same length as the tube. Corolla imbricate; tube narrow, the throat almost closed by longitudinal folds at the base of the lobes; regular; white; persistent, or deciduous. Androecium 5. Androecial members adnate (to the corolla); all equal; free of one another; 1 -whorled. Androecium exclusively of fertile stamens. Stamens 5; isomerous with the perianth; oppositisepalous; all alternating with the corolla members. Anthers basifixed, or adnate; becoming inverted during development, their morphological bases ostensibly apical in the mature stamens; non-versatile; dehiscing via longitudinal slits (by a single median slit); finally introrse (inverting during development); unilocular, or bilocular; bisporangiate; unappendaged. Pollen shed in aggregates, or shed as single grains; without viscin strands; in diads, or in triplets, or in tetrads. Gynoecium 5 carpelled. The pistil 5 celled. Gynoecium syncarpous; eu-syncarpous; superior. Ovary plurilocular; 5 locular. Gynoecium stylate. Styles 1; from a depression at the top of the ovary; apical. Stigmas 1; truncate, or clavate, or capitate. Placentation axile. Ovules 3–20 per locule (i.e. ‘several’); pendulous; non-arillate; anatropous.

Fruit and seed features. Fruit non-fleshy; dehiscent; a capsule. Capsules loculicidal. Seeds endospermic. Endosperm oily. Seeds wingless. Embryo well differentiated. Cotyledons 2. Embryo straight. Seedling. Germination phanerocotylar.

Physiology, biochemistry. Aluminium accumulation not found. Photosynthetic pathway: C3.

Geography, cytology, number of species. Native of Australia. Endemic to Australia. Australian states and territories: Western Australia. South-West Botanical Province.

Additional characters Prophylls few.
